Output e65823a31a7ffafa32d1ed23e20eef347b9dd1367922b8a015ee6de4e3243a08:0

value
5000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9625e8134fa45e70998fec861a20c80f51dc287 OP_EQUAL
address
3JbEmqkdoRXRkUhc1HsuF5sZVHP5QYzVG2
transaction
e65823a31a7ffafa32d1ed23e20eef347b9dd1367922b8a015ee6de4e3243a08
confirmations
170136
spent
true